Summary: | UROCIT-K is a potassium-citrate regimen prescribed for the prevention of kidney stone formation. In 2013, K-CITEK was introduced to the local market as a new potassium-citrate regimen that reduces kidney stone formation in a declared rate of 93.
We sought to explore the efficacy of K-CITEK versus UROCIT-K.
A prospective database of patients treated with potassium-citrate regimens for nephrolithiasis has been reviewed. Patients were divided into two groups: those who were treated with UROCIT-K only (Group 1) and those who were treated with K-CITEK only (Group 2). The two groups were compared as regards to demographics, length of follow-up, urinary citrate level and stone burden changes, as well as the number of stone events (i.e: colic, surgery) throughout the follow-up period. In a separate analysis another group (Group 3) was checked. This group consisted of patients who were initially treated with UROCIT-K and later on were switched to K-CITEK.
The study group consisted of 104 patients: 54 patients in Group 1, 38 in group 2 and 12 in group 3. The latter was omitted from analysis due to the small size. Groups 1 and 2 resembled in their demographic data and medical comorbidities. No statistically significant differences were found in terms of change in urinary citrate levels, stone burden or recurrent stone events.
K-CITEK for the treatment of kidney stone prevention was found to be as equally effective as UROCIT-K in terms of increasing urinary citrate levels, reducing stone burden and maintaining the intervals between kidney stone events. |
